Fitbit App Not Working | Fitbit App Down

The Fitbit app, a popular tool for tracking health and fitness, has been facing a series of technical issues that have persisted for several hours. The company, which is owned by Google, officially acknowledged these problems on a Wednesday night.

In a message posted on X (formerly known as Twitter) at 8:01 PM ET, Fitbit expressed its awareness of the situation and its commitment to addressing the ongoing issues. Their statement read, “We’re aware that some customers are experiencing issues with the Fitbit app, and we are currently investigating. We sincerely apologize for the inconvenience, and we thank you for your patience.” However, they couldn’t provide a specific time frame for when these issues would be resolved, leaving users uncertain about when they could expect a resolution.

Visiting Fitbit’s community page revealed a prominent banner that stated, “We’re continuing to investigate the issue affecting Fitbit devices. Thank you for your patience.” This sign clearly indicated that Fitbit was actively working on finding a solution but that the problem had not yet been fully resolved.

This situation has not gone unnoticed, with several news outlets and social media platforms discussing these Fitbit app outages. For instance, Android Authority reported that within the app, data failed to load properly, and the Coach tab displayed a frustrating “content not available” message. Additionally, 9to5Google noted a similar issue, where users were unable to access their fitness statistics within the app, further complicating their experience.
